
Classes | |
| class | TapClass |
Functions | |
| TapClass * | TapCreate (void) |
| Create TapClass instance. return Address for instance of TapClass. | |
| int | TapOpen (FAR TapClass *ins, FAR ST_TAP_OPEN *OpenParam) |
| Set coefficients necessary for parameter initialization and tap detection. More... | |
| int | TapClose (FAR TapClass *ins) |
| None. More... | |
| int | TapWrite (FAR TapClass *ins, FAR ST_TAP_ACCEL *accelData) |
| Detect tap. More... | |
| int | TapWrite_timestamp (FAR TapClass *ins, FAR ST_TAP_ACCEL *accelData, uint64_t time_stamp) |
| Detect tap. More... | |
| int TapOpen | ( | FAR TapClass * | ins, |
| FAR ST_TAP_OPEN * | OpenParam | ||
| ) |
Set coefficients necessary for parameter initialization and tap detection.
| [in] | ins | : instance address of TapClass |
| int TapClose | ( | FAR TapClass * | ins | ) |
| int TapWrite | ( | FAR TapClass * | ins, |
| FAR ST_TAP_ACCEL * | accelData | ||
| ) |
Detect tap.
| [in] | ins | : instance address of TapClass |
| [in] | accelData | : Accel Data |
| int TapWrite_timestamp | ( | FAR TapClass * | ins, |
| FAR ST_TAP_ACCEL * | accelData, | ||
| uint64_t | time_stamp | ||
| ) |
Detect tap.
| [in] | ins | : instance address of TapClass |
| [in] | accelData | : Accel Data |
| [in] | time_stamp | : Time Stamp |